Frank, I think investors were disappointed with the LACK of substance, not the poor presentation.

You suggest the "substance" of IDC is visible on the financial statements under the components of royalties and special engineering. I think it would be dangerous to afford too much weight to this line. Yes, they are combined under a single line on the financial statements. One would think that royalties would be reported separately from special engineering which more akin to contract labor than royalties. One is a service, the other is a licensing of technology.

It is reasonable to assume that management is trying to obscure the true source of their income. I have never seen another corporation lump royalties with income derived from services.

Fortunately there is a real shortage of skilled engineers so engineering services are in high demand and this allows the perception to continue that IDC is a good royalty play but how long can this continue?
